Category: None Group: None Status: Open Resolution: None Priority: 5 Submitted By: Mantas (mantaz) Assigned to: Nobody/Anonymous (nobody) Summary: python and lithuanian locales Initial Comment: python's locale.py file contains only one lithuanian locale Iso 8859-4 which is obsolete. Now almost all uses iso 8859-13. Lithuanian locale is called lt, and i think it must be named lt_lt. ---------------------------------------------------------------------- Comment By: Serge Orlov (sorlov) Date: 2005-03-09 19:56 Message: Logged In: YES user_id=1235914 The fix is in Python 2.5.
